VHold HD
Turned out to be a nice little camera. 135degree wide angle. 16Gig hard drive - 4 hours a battery.
Cylindrical form is fairly aerodynamic. - way more than GoPro.
Helmet mount was a little challenging but I think I got it figured out finally.
